16 Alexander Avenue, Enderby, Leicester, LE19 4NA is a freehold terraced property built between 1900-1929. The property offers approximately 721 square feet of living space. In this location, properties of similar size usually have two bedrooms.

The estimated current market value of the property is £213,939 , which equates to approximately £297 per square foot. It was last sold on 5 Mar 2019 for £165,500. Since then, the value has increased by £48,439, representing a 29.3% increase, or approximately 4.3% per year.

The current estimated value of £213,939 is:

  • 4.8% lower than the average property price on Alexander Avenue
  • 15.7% lower than the average in the LE19 4NA postcode area
  • and 36.5% lower than the average price for Leicester as a whole

At the most recent EPC inspection on 16 October 2018, the property was recorded as owner-occupied.

EPC Summary

16 Alexander Avenue, Enderby, Leicester, Blaby, Leicestershire, LE19 4NA has an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) rating of D, based on the latest assessment carried out on 16 Oct 2018.

This property uses a gas-fired boiler and radiators, connected to the mains gas supply, as its main heating source. Hot water is provided from main heating system. The windows are fully double glazed.

The previous EPC assessment was conducted on 18 Jan 2010. The rating of D remains the same, but the energy efficiency score improved by 12.5%.

Since the previous assessment, several changes were observed:

  • The roof construction or insulation changed from pitched, no insulation (assumed) to pitched, 150 mm loft insulation, improving energy efficiency from very poor to good.
  • The lighting was updated from no low energy lighting to low energy lighting in 60% of fixed outlets, with efficiency improving from very poor to good.
